Aden UI — Component Platform
Aden UI is the official platform behind the community — an interactive component library specifically for Angular developers. Every component is presented in a live playground, follows the latest Angular standards and is ready to use via copy-paste. The platform also offers a growing collection of custom frontend guides as a personal reference.
Repository is private — the platform is publicly accessible.

What is Aden UI?
A component library platform with three core areas:
- Playground — Test every component live in the browser and copy the code directly
- Components — Curated Angular components following modern standards
- Guides — Personal frontend guides as a central reference
The platform runs in the browser and as a desktop app via Electron — for developers who want to access their components and guides offline.

Component Standards
All components on Aden UI follow the same quality standards:
- Angular Signals —
input(),output(),signal(),computed()instead of classic decorators - Standalone Components —
standalone: true, no NgModules - Accessibility — ARIA attributes, keyboard navigation, semantic HTML
- Copy-Paste Ready — No hidden dependencies, directly usable
- Responsive — Works from 320px to desktop

What I Learned
- Electron — Converting a web app into a desktop application and understanding the specifics of the main/renderer process model
- Dev Container — Containerizing development environments so that onboarding is reduced to seconds
- Component API Design — Designing components so other developers can use them intuitively without having to read documentation
- Platform Thinking — The difference between a project and a platform that other developers use and build upon
